Step-by-step explanation:
1) I assume you want the derivative of (cos x - sin x) / ( cos x + sin x).
y' = (cosx + sinx)( -sinx - cosx) - (cosx - sinx)(-sinx + cosx)
---------------------------------------------------------------------------
(cosx + sinx)^2
= -sinxcosx - cos^2x - sin^2x - sinxcosx - (-sinxcosx+cos^2x+sin^2x-sinxcosx
-------------------------------------------------------------------------------------------------------
(cosx + sinx)^2
= -2sinxcosx - 1 - ( -2sinxcosx + 1 ) / (cosx + sinx)^2
= -2sinxcosx - 1 - ( -2sinxcosx + 1 ) / (cosx + sinx)^2
= - 2 / (cos x + sinx)^2.
